1. What is ISO 9001 Certification?
ISO 9001 is the world’s most recognized standard for quality management systems (QMS). Developed by the International Organization for Standardization (ISO), it provides a framework for businesses to ensure consistent quality in their products and services. When a company achieves ISO 9001 certification, it means they’ve demonstrated the ability to meet customer and regulatory requirements with a structured, process-driven approach.

4. How to Get Started
The journey to certification starts with understanding the standard’s requirements. Businesses typically perform a gap analysis, implement necessary process improvements, and train staff on the new system. Partnering with a qualified consultant or certification body can simplify the process and increase your chances of success. Once ready, an accredited auditor conducts a formal assessment before awarding certification.
